**Nightly Search Reindex — Environment Variables**

The Pellgrove reindex job runs at 02:00 and rebuilds the catalog index for Mistral Shelf. Support staff restarting it manually must confirm `REINDEX_BATCH_SIZE` and `REINDEX_LOCALE` are set first, or documents may be skipped silently. The job also authenticates to the indexing cluster, so the cluster secret must appear directly below this sentence.

sealed setting: RELAY_SECRET5=82864

Q: Can I use the goods lift at Pelton Yard? A: Only if you're moving actual deliveries — it's reserved for couriers and facilities, so no sneaky shortcuts with your lunch. If you do have a legit bulky delivery to move, book a slot with the post room first. The lift panel is code-locked, and the current access code is:

door code, tahof-yajog: bdg-C-65

# Client setup for the Mosstile render cache.
# This client talks to the Slatecache layer that fronts the tile
# renderer; it serves pre-rendered tiles and falls back to Mosstile
# on miss. Cache entries expire after six hours, so stale tiles are
# expected near the TTL boundary. Maintainers should not bypass the
# cache except for debugging. The client authenticates to the
# internal Slatecache gateway with the service key below.

service key, bajep-hahig: zpat15_8GdlyV2kd9BCqYH

## Recovery: Relevance Tuning Workspace

Hey — if you get locked out of the Quartzen relevance workspace (where all the tuning notes for the Bramblewick search index live), don't file a ticket first. Just use the recovery flow from the admin panel; it's faster. The workspace owner account, farrow-ops, is the one to recover. When prompted, enter the passphrase shown below.

unlock words, tawif-tahop: oliys-ulawyn-tamdor-lamys-casox-jormir-fraius-kasath-ulador-ulamir-holir-sorys-holeth

## Service Accounts — Report Export Timezones

The Ledgerline export worker renders all scheduled reports in the tenant's configured timezone, not UTC, so release validation must use the `tz-probe` service account to confirm offsets after any deploy touching the scheduler. This account is scoped to read-only export runs and cannot modify tenant settings. Before signing off a release, run the probe with the credential that follows.

service key, fawip-bajef: kto11_Qt5wZK9vdNC